  • I work on cars for a living. I'm an instructor at a Local Tech College, and i do side work at home, and I get a littl leary about what work I take on and for whom, because I know the liability I take on when I do. It is sad but MANY people who do work for "under the table" pay, and even shop owners are not aware of the amount of liability they assume when they accept a vehicle to do work on. I hope this is a lesson to anyone who wants to do this work.
